What is U0A77?
The U0A77 diagnostic trouble code (DTC) indicates a communication bus off condition, primarily related to the vehicle's network communication systems. This code typically surfaces when the vehicle's control modules are unable to communicate effectively due to signal interruptions. It can affect several systems, including the engine, transmission, and stability control systems. When your vehicle's onboard computer detects a fault in the communication bus, it may trigger warning lights on the dashboard, such as the check engine light, and can lead to performance issues. The implications can be significant, particularly for vehicles made between 2016 and 2021, where many systems are interconnected and rely heavily on data exchange for optimal functioning. In some cases, you might experience symptoms like erratic dashboard indicators, loss of power steering, or even failure to start. Addressing the U0A77 code promptly is crucial to prevent further complications and ensure your vehicle operates smoothly.

Symptoms
Common symptoms when U0A77 is present:
- Check engine light stays illuminated constantly, indicating a fault in the vehicle's communication systems.
- Dashboard warning lights flicker or behave erratically, suggesting issues with the communication between various modules.
- Loss of power steering assist, which could make handling the vehicle more challenging, especially at low speeds.
- Difficulty starting the engine, where the vehicle may crank but fail to start due to communication failures.
- Intermittent issues with the vehicle's stability control system, leading to unexpected handling characteristics.
Possible Causes
Most common causes of U0A77 (ordered by frequency):
- The most common cause of U0A77 is a faulty wiring harness or loose connections, which can occur in about 60% of cases. Check the wiring for damage or corrosion.
- A malfunctioning control module, which may be caused by internal faults or software issues, accounts for around 25% of occurrences. Updating or replacing the module can resolve this.
- Poor battery connections can lead to insufficient power for module communication, making up about 10% of cases. Ensure battery terminals are clean and tight.
- Less common but serious causes include water intrusion in electronic control units (ECUs), which can lead to significant damage and are often costly to repair.
- Rarely, a manufacturing defect in the vehicle’s communication system could be responsible, which might necessitate a recall or service bulletin for resolution.

Real Repair Case Studies
Case Study 1: Resolving U0A77 in a 2019 Ford Fusion
Vehicle: 2019 Ford Fusion, 25,000 miles
Problem: Customer reported a persistent check engine light and loss of power steering.
Diagnosis: After using the GeekOBD APP, a U0A77 code was confirmed, with additional codes for power steering failure. A visual inspection revealed corroded connectors in the wiring harness.
Solution: Repaired the wiring harness and cleaned the connectors, followed by clearing the codes and performing a road test to confirm functionality.
Cost: $220 (parts and labor)
Result: The vehicle operated normally post-repair, with no return of the U0A77 code.
Case Study 2: U0A77 Issue in a 2018 Ford Escape
Vehicle: 2018 Ford Escape, 40,000 miles
Problem: Driver experienced intermittent dashboard warning lights and difficulty starting.
Diagnosis: Diagnostic scan showed U0A77 along with several other codes. Further testing revealed a failing control module.
Solution: Replaced the control module, reprogrammed it, and cleared all codes.
Cost: $850 (including parts and programming)
Result: The vehicle was restored to full functionality, and no further issues were reported.
